Description:
Guests are invited to the Conrad Mansion this December 6th, 7th, and 8th to hear the live radio version of Charles Dickens’ A Christmas Carol, based on Orson Welles’ original play. Actors from the Gypsy Theatre Guild will be on the second floor as guests listen to the 90-minute holiday classic in the Mansion’s festively decorated Great Hall. All proceeds benefit the Conrad Mansion and the Gypsy Theatre Guild!
Reservations are required.
